what is 'amylin'?

Definition for Amylin

Amylin, or Islet Amyloid Polypeptide (IAPP), is a 37-residue peptide hormone secreted by pancreatic ?-cells at the same time as insulin (in a roughly 1:100 amylin:insulin ratio). [ 1 ]

Islet, or insulinoma, amyloid polypeptide (IAPP, or amylin) is commonly found in pancreatic islets of patients suffering diabetes mellitus type 2 , or harboring an insulinoma . more
